[QUOTE="331 LX, post: 15514740, member: 14310"] Thank you, It's finally starting to look like a bar! Thank you! It really was wasted space, so I had to do it. I love my basement man. Thank you man! I don't know if I said this in here or not but I will use the same for the foot rail and antique it in copper. Same with the shelves. Thanks again for all the comments. I appreciate it and it keeps me rollin. Now for an update- So, things have slowed down a bit. I was in a pretty gnarly car wreck Thursday and didn't get much of anything done over the weekend. :eek: I got some of the barn wood up, stain finished and laid some poly down. I researched and researched on laying this poly and still had a mess. After the first coat of poly there were quite a bit of bubbles so I hit it with 220 and cleaned it with some mineral spirits. Once I laid the second coat it looked to be going on better but once I got to the big part of the bottom bar it started to bubble again. I may try to hit it with 180 lightly and see if I can get them out. It really pisses me off. Any help would be appreciated. I added another 2x4x10 for some more support for this crispy ass old barn wood.
